Promoter in Berlin's techno club is recruited by secret services as undercover insider. I just watched this on Amazon and it's probably one of their grittier imports. Overall, I liked it. It had a complex story (more than it initially seems), a conflicted good guy, a very smart bad guy and spy service that sometimes is good and other times is bad.
Overall, I think the story was fairly complex and only at the very end you are able to unroll the layers. Dubbing wasn't that good but i guess there are no good dubbing out there.
At times, I felt some of the flashbacks were a bit much but I also don't like flashbacks in general.
A bit more detail about the main players:
The main hero is a conflicted techno club organizer that is being manipulated (I don't have to give up anything but it's much more than it seems) into being a under cover agent for secret service.
Bad guy seems to be cold blooded, calculating and extremely intelligent; thus proving a worthy opponent.
The secret police is more of a challenge. You never know where they stand and what they want. Only later we know realize their true motives. Keeps things very interesting.
Music is techno and visuals are bit dark and lots of gray. I was never a clubber myself, but I think I could see them doing a good job with it, that at times I felt I was in that chaos, where anything and everything was OK.
Overall, I enjoyed it.

There is something about continental European dramas. The writing is often quirkier and there's always a fresh feel to them. When I saw the cast list made up of Niewöhner, Berkel, Koffler and Ullmann I had to watch. Ullmann is fantastic... He looks like he's really enjoying this role.
Update; (possible spoiler) I finished the series and really enjoyed it. It went in a little bit of a different direction than I expected. I thought Ullmann's role was - after seeing the first episode - going to be bigger and that he would be the main antagonist. Probably a little bit of misdirection on behalf of the writers but I'm not complaining.
Definitely worth 7 hours of your time.

I´m a Berliner myself and even though I´m 54, I can relate to the club scene and the story in this series. Beat is somebody I wouldn´t like to let too close to me but Jannis Niewöhner´s acting is irresistible. He has what an actor needs to make such a character come to life. I immediately fell in love with him, I must admit. The story is gripping and that´s because the whole package works. Acting, directing, camera, lighting, sites, a high production value and unfortunately there is no season 2 yet. I would love to have this series continued, the ending promised such a voyage.
